What is LaunchNotes?
LaunchNotes operates as a specialized Product Success Platform designed to optimize the product development cycle for software-centric organizations. In an era where product velocity is a primary competitive advantage, the platform provides a unified interface for managing product updates, stakeholder feedback, and roadmap visibility. By integrating seamlessly into existing workflows, LaunchNotes ensures that cross-functional teams—from engineering to customer success—remain aligned on product evolution. This market position is reinforced by a client base that includes industry leaders such as Amplitude, Loom, and Drata, validating the platform's utility in complex, fast-paced environments.
How much funding has LaunchNotes raised?
LaunchNotes has raised a total of $16.8M across 2 funding rounds:
Angel/Seed
$1.8M
Series A
$15M
Angel/Seed (2020): $1.8M with participation from Bull City Venture Partners, Cowboy Ventures, and Essence Venture Capital
Series A (2022): $15M led by The New Normal Fund, Essence Venture Capital, Insight Partners, Bull City Venture Partners, Atlassian, and Cowboy Ventures
Key Investors in LaunchNotes
Bull City Venture Partners
Bull City Venture Partners is a venture capital firm specializing in B2B software investments, dedicated to supporting early-stage founders who are shaping the future of technology.
Cowboy Ventures
Cowboy Ventures is a seed fund focused on Enterprise SaaS and AI-native software, providing hands-on assistance in product strategy and fundraising to help founders build generational companies.
Essence Venture Capital
Essence Venture Capital specializes in infrastructure-focused investments, supporting technical founders in navigating leadership transitions and building robust developer communities.
